Reference specification
| Item | Value |
|---|---|
| Model | Flux 3 |
| Brand | Air Bar |
| Category | Pod Systems |
| Battery | 800 mAh |
| Output range | 8-30 W |
| Capacity | 3.0 ml |
| Charging | Magnetic dock |
| Coil options | 1.0 / 1.2 ohm |
| Carton quantity | 200 units |

Checklist
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.

Frequently asked questions
How often should Flux 3 be cleaned?
A quick contact clean every week or two, with a fuller clean monthly, suits most usage patterns.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
